Institutional repositories are deposits of different types of digital files for access, disseminate and preserve them. This paper aims to explain the importance of repositories in the academic field of engineering as a way to democratize knowledge by teachers, researchers and students to contribute to social and human development. These repositories, usually framed in the Open Access Initiative, allow to ensure access free and open (unrestricted legal and economic) to different sectors of society and, thus, can make use of the services they offer. Finally, that repositories are evolving in the academic and scientific, and different disciplines of engineering should be prepared to provide a range of services through these systems to society of today and tomorrow.

The Institutional Repositories (IR) have been consolidated into the institutions in scientific and academic areas, as shown by the directories existing open access repositories and the deposits daily of articles made by different ways, such as by sel f-archiving of registered users and the cataloging by librarians. IR systems are based on various conceptual models, so in this paper a bibliographic survey Model-Driven Development (MDD) in systems and applications for RI in order to expose the benefits of applying MDD in IR. The MDD is a paradigm for building software that assigns a central role models and active under which derive models ranging from the most abstract to the concrete, this is done through successive transformations. This paradigm provides a framework that allows interested parties to share their views and directly manipulate representations of the entities of this domain. Therefore, the benefits are grouped by actors that are present, namely, developers, business owners and domain experts. In conclusion, these benefits help make more formal software implementations, resulting in a consolidation of such systems, where the main beneficiaries are the end users through the services are offered

The search process of scientific articles (papers) and review articles (reviews) is one of the pillars of the scientific world, and is performed by people in the research as well as for people who want to keep abreast specific topics. Scopus (there a re other databases) or Google Scholar are proposed options to find articles, but is recommended by Scopus its extensive database and its versatility in the search options it offers. This paper proposes is a plan that allows a systematic search and keep the items in an orderly, consistent and coherent within own repository for cataloging and consultation, which will serve for many tasks to establish the state of the art of a topic, staff training in an area and/or writing articles, among others.
Being aware of the motivation problems observed in many scientific oriented careers, we present two experiences to expose to college students to environments, methodologies and discovery techniques addressing contemporary problems. This experiences a re developed in two complementary contexts: an Introductory Physics course, where we motivated to physics students to participate in research activities, and a multidisciplinary hotbed of research oriented to advanced undergraduate students of Science and Engineering (that even produced three poster presentations in international conferences). Although these are preliminary results and require additional editions to get statistical significance, we consider they are encouraging results. On both contexts we observe an increase in the students motivation to orient their careers with emphasizing on research. In this work, besides the contextualization support for these experiences, we describe six specific activities to link our students to research areas, which we believe can be replicated on similar environments in other educational institutions.
This paper presents a finite-volume method, together with fully adaptive multi-resolution scheme to obtain spatial adaptation, and a Runge-Kutta-Fehlberg scheme with a local time-varying step to obtain temporal adaptation, to solve numerically the kn own bidominio equations that model the electrical activity of the tissue in the myocardium. Two simple models are considered for membrane flows and ionic currents. First we define an approximate solution and we verify its convergence to the corresponding weak solution of the continuum problem, obtaining in this way an alternative demonstration that the continuum problem is well-posed. Next we introduce the multiresolution technique and derive an optimal noise reduction threshold.
